Open now and opening soon: Toronto’s newest restaurants

Sep 20 2018, 7:39 pm

This weekly round-up spotlights Toronto’s newest restaurants and bars, plus incoming establishments that should be on your radar.

Here are the newest restaurants opening in Toronto right now:

Just Opened

  • Burgers n’ Fries Forever has officially opened its first Toronto outpost at 182 Ossington Avenue.
  • Toronto’s Friends-inspired Central Cafe is now open at 52 Bathurst Street.
  • Eat BKK is open is Leslieville. The Thai kitchen takes over the former Lady Marmalade address at 898 Queen Street East.
  • Good Hombres, a new taqueria and tortillería from the folks behind Campenchano is opening open as of today at 374 Bathurst Street.
  • iQ Food Co. just opened its latest outpost at Yorkdale Shopping Centre at 3401 Dufferin Street.
  • Pilot Coffee Roasters is now open at 117 Ossington Avenue.
  • Tertulia cafe at 711 Queen East in Riverside is now open for business.

Opening Soon

  • Casa Fuego, a new spot for South American BBQ is in the works at 230 Adelaide Street West.
  • Labothéry, build-your-own bubble tea lab is opening a second outpost inside the PATH at the Richmond Adelaide-Centre this fall.
  • Louix Louis is set to open on the 31st floor of the incoming St. Regis Toronto at 325 Bay Street.
  • The Peacock Public House will replace the short-lived Mad Crush Wine Bar at 582 College according to NOW.
  • The Soup Bar from Feed It Forward is Toronto’s newest pay what you can restaurant opening September 25 at Toronto’s Humber North Campus.
  • Shy Coffee Co. is coming soon to 766 King Street West,
  • Sugarfina is opening its first standalone store in Toronto inside First Canadian Place.
